What this data tells you about Kluesner
Lauren Kluesner is a physician assistant in Peoria, IL, with 3 years of NPI registration. Based on federal Medicare data, Kluesner performed 2,989 Medicare services in 2023. These records do not provide a deduplicated patient total.
Between the years covered by Open Payments, Kluesner received a total of $661 from 6 pharmaceutical and/or device companies across 10 payment records. A record can group multiple payments. These transfers are publicly reported through CMS Open Payments. Disclosure alone does not establish their effect on care. A reliable breakdown by payment category is not available in this snapshot.
